array( 'address_complete'=>$data->results[0]->formatted-6ren">
gpt4 book ai didi

php - 如何将数组插入mysql数据库?

转载 作者:搜寻专家 更新时间:2023-10-30 20:52:10 24 4
gpt4 key购买 nike

我有以下数组:

$dati = array(
"data" => array(
'address_complete'=>$data->results[0]->formatted_address,
'address_square'=>$data->results[0]->address_components[1]->long_name,
'location'=>$data->results[0]->address_components[2]->long_name,
'postal_code'=>$data->results[0]->address_components[7]->long_name,
'data_ora'=>$tmp_date
)
);

我想在数据库中插入 $dati["data"]['location']。我该如何修复

mysql_query("INSERT into utenti(city) VALUES ('$dati[data][location]')") or die (mysql_error());

?

最佳答案

首先,使用适当的变量插值:

mysql_query("INSERT into utenti(city) VALUES ('{$dati["data"]["location"]}')") or die (mysql_error());

其次mysql_ 扩展已弃用,请改用MySQLiPDO_MySQL

关于php - 如何将数组插入mysql数据库?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38577403/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com